What You'll Do

    • Implement and monitor projects within a specific set of clients under the direction of senior team members.
    • Work closely with and support the needs of the client servicing teams. Responsibilities include but not limited to the following:
    • Media relations – media monitoring, schedule and coordinate with third parties on events, assist with preparation of press kits, update media list, assist with compilation of reports and support product seeding.
    • Work closely with senior team members on multiple industry, media landscape and influencers research studies across a variety of industries and clients and Edelman internal initiatives.
    • Assist with project set-up and coordination with multiple service providers.
    • Familiarity with translation, press release writing, draft pitch emails, copywriting, conduct and compile research as directed by supervisors.
    • Help prepare informal and formal client reports and presentation materials.

Edelman is a global communications firm that partners with businesses and organizations to evolve, promote and protect their brands and reputations. Our 6,000 people in more than 60 offices deliver communications strategies that give our clients the confidence to lead and act with certainty, earning the trust of their stakeholders. Our honors include the Cannes Lions Grand Prix for PR; Advertising Age’s 2019 A-List; the Holmes Report’s 2018 Global Digital Agency of the Year; and, five times, Glassdoor’s Best Places to Work. Since our founding in 1952, we have remained an independent, family-run business. Edelman owns specialty companies Edelman Data & Intelligence (DxI) and United Entertainment Group (entertainment, sports, lifestyle).
